Blue Moonshine, any experience???
I got some Blue Moonshine seeds from a friend who claims to have won a north west US cannabis cup with this same stuff.
He says its:
Blueberry x C99 x White Widow
Is this the Blue Moonshine that I hear about on these boards, or is it just the same name.
Also, if anyone has any experience in growing this plant that I described above, let me know if there's anything I should prepare for, or some tips would be great.

'Blue Moonshine' was a Blueberry strain, from Dutch Passion Seeds ... pretty much a straight Indica, no C99 or White Widow in the mix, to my knowledge ... your friend may have made his own hybrid from it, but otherwise, pretty much a straight Blueberry (which can be very nice smoke, but, can also be finicky to grow) :jointsmile:

Blue Moonshine is one of the earliest maturing members of the Blue Family. This hybrid originated in the early 1990s. Not a commercial variety, this super potent Blueberry - Indica, covered with standing THC trichomes. Taste and high are impressive, a connaiseurs delight. Characteristic is the long lasting narcotic body high. The average yield is is compensated by the pure quality of the smoke. Short (80 cm) stout Kush plants that produce dense, tight, rock-hard nuggets of trichome-coated bud. A true "hash plant".
